Brake Pad Wear

Brake pad wear depends on the severity of usage
and track conditions. (Generally, the pads will
wear faster on wet and dirty tracks.) Inspect the
brake pads at each regular maintenance interval
(page 29).
Front Brake Pads
Inspect the brake pads (1) through the front wheel
to determine the brake pad wear. If either brake
pad is worn anywhere to a thickness of 1 mm (0.04
in), both brake pads must be replaced.

Rear Brake Pads
Inspect the brake pads (1) from the rear side of the
caliper to determine the brake pad wear. If either
brake pad is worn anywhere to a thickness of 1 mm
(0.04 in), both brake pads must be replaced.

Other Inspections
Check that the front brake lever and rear brake
pedal assemblies are positioned properly (page 95)
and the securing bolts are tight.
Make sure there are no fluid leaks. Check for
deterioration or cracks in the hoses and fittings.
